Output bb20be7662e160a25e80a2a9ebfc7de2633bc772e68c252e5ca33baf2c6d5a3d:25

value
392972801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26109f0600fb6ffaaed68188bd79a770f69cd341 OP_EQUAL
address
35AHWhBEhcFRxwiYV4v747nUiXAJHBFASG
transaction
bb20be7662e160a25e80a2a9ebfc7de2633bc772e68c252e5ca33baf2c6d5a3d
confirmations
362934
spent
true